Thanksgiving Quotes To Friends

“Gratitude is not only the greatest of virtues, but the parent of all others.”Cicero

This quote drives home how important gratitude is in our lives. When we express our appreciation to friends, we create an atmosphere where other virtues like kindness, love, and compassion can also grow. We should recognize how expressing thanks to our friends not only strengthens our relationships but also nurtures a positive cycle of goodwill that enriches our lives together.

“Thank you for being a friend. Thank you for being there when I need you.”Unknown Author

Acknowledging efforts made by friends is essential, and this quote highlights that perfectly. We can all think of those moments when our friends stepped up when we needed them most. By conveying our gratitude, we remind them how special their presence is in our lives. We can use quotes like this to make them feel valued and cherished.
